rkjnt Philippians:2:12-18
rkjnt@Philippians:2:12 @ Therefore, my beloved, as you have always obeyed, so now, not only in my presence, but much more in my absence, work out your own salvation with fear and trembling.
rkjnt@Philippians:2:13 @ For it is God who works in you both to will and to do his good pleasure.
rkjnt@Philippians:2:14 @ Do all things without grumbling and disputing:
rkjnt@Philippians:2:15 @ That you may be blameless and innocent, the children of God, without blemish, in the midst of a crooked and perverse generation, among whom you shine as lights in the world;
rkjnt@Philippians:2:16 @ Holding forth the word of life; that I may rejoice in the day of Christ, that I have not run in vain, nor laboured in vain.
rkjnt@Philippians:2:17 @ Even if I am poured out as a drink offering upon the sacrifice and service of your faith, I am glad, and rejoice with you all.
rkjnt@Philippians:2:18 @ In the same way, you also should be glad, and rejoice with me.
